Why do my copper pipes keep developing small leaks?

Copper pipes from 1988 often develop pinhole leaks due to electrolytic corrosion and scale buildup. The hard water in our area accelerates this process, particularly at joints and elbows. These failures typically start appearing after 30-35 years of service. Proper dielectric unions and regular pressure checks can help identify weak points before they fail completely.

As a rural homeowner, what plumbing systems need special attention?

Rural properties around Longtown typically have well and septic systems that require regular maintenance. Well pumps and pressure tanks need annual checks, while septic systems should be inspected every 3-5 years. Water quality testing is essential with private wells. These systems operate independently from municipal utilities, making preventive care more critical for avoiding emergencies.

Does Lake Eufaula water damage my home's plumbing fixtures?

Water drawn from Lake Eufaula contains high mineral content that causes scale buildup throughout your plumbing system. Water heaters suffer most, with elements coating in calcium deposits that reduce efficiency by 30-40% over time. Fixtures develop restricted flow, and showerheads lose pressure. Installing a whole-house water softener or regular descaling extends appliance life significantly.
